Water abstraction in Cubic Meters per capita per year (2008-2012)
This layer presents water abstraction in Cubic Meters per capita per year for 32 countries (23 in Europe and North America, 5 in Asia and the Pacific, 4 in Latin America and the...This layer presents water abstraction in Cubic Meters per capita per year for 32 countries (23 in Europe and North America, 5 in Asia and the Pacific, 4 in Latin America and the Caribbean) at the most recent date between 2008 and 2012. However, data are available from 1975 to 2014 for 39 countries. Water abstractions or water withdrawals, are defined as freshwater taken from ground or surface water sources, either permanently or temporarily, and conveyed to a place of use. The data include abstractions for public water supply, irrigation, industrial processes, cooling of electric power plants, mine water and drainage water.For more information, visit the OECD database: https://data.oecd.org/water/water-withdrawals.htm#indicator-chart
